The Nigerian Railway Corporation (NRC) has been actively working to enhance the movement of goods via rail across the nation. In the first half of 2024, the NRC generated over ₦1.14 billion in revenue from goods transported by rail, marking a 221% increase compared to the same period in 2023.
To further facilitate cargo movement, the NRC signed a memorandum of understanding with the Nigerian Shippers Council in August 2024. This agreement aims to streamline the transportation of goods from seaports to inland dry ports, thereby enhancing efficiency in the logistics network.
Despite these advancements, achieving 100% movement of goods through rail nationwide remains a significant challenge. The NRC continues to face obstacles such as infrastructure limitations, vandalism, and the need for increased public adoption of rail transport for cargo. Ongoing efforts are focused on addressing these issues to further improve the rail freight system.
